全景视频监控系统如何实现高效存储?

随着科技的不断发展,全景视频监控系统在各个领域的应用越来越广泛。然而,如何实现高效存储全景视频数据成为了一个亟待解决的问题。本文将深入探讨全景视频监控系统如何实现高效存储,并分析相关技术及解决方案。

一、全景视频监控系统概述

全景视频监控系统是一种通过多个摄像头同时采集画面,然后将这些画面进行拼接处理,形成一幅全方位、无死角的视频画面。它具有以下特点:

  1. 视野范围广:可以覆盖更大范围的监控区域,提高监控效率。
  2. 真实还原场景:全景视频可以真实还原监控场景,便于事后回溯和分析。
  3. 防范能力增强:全方位监控可以有效防范各类安全风险。

二、全景视频数据存储的挑战

全景视频监控系统在数据存储方面面临以下挑战:

  1. 数据量庞大:由于全景视频画面包含大量像素,因此数据量巨大。
  2. 数据冗余:全景视频画面中存在大量重复信息,导致存储空间浪费。
  3. 数据更新频繁:监控场景不断变化,需要实时更新数据。

三、全景视频数据存储解决方案

针对上述挑战,以下是一些全景视频数据存储解决方案:

  1. 数据压缩技术

数据压缩是减少数据存储量的关键。目前,常用的全景视频数据压缩技术有:

  • H.264/AVC: 一种国际视频编码标准,广泛应用于高清视频压缩。
  • H.265/HEVC: 一种新型视频编码标准,相比H.264/AVC,具有更高的压缩效率。

案例分析:某城市采用H.265/HEVC技术对全景视频进行压缩,相比H.264/AVC,数据量降低了40%,有效缓解了存储压力。


  1. 分布式存储系统

分布式存储系统可以将数据分散存储在多个节点上,提高存储效率和可靠性。常见的分布式存储系统有:

  • Hadoop HDFS: 一种分布式文件系统,适用于大规模数据存储。
  • Ceph: 一种开源分布式存储系统,支持多种存储介质。

案例分析:某大型企业采用Ceph分布式存储系统存储全景视频数据,提高了存储性能和可靠性。


  1. 数据去重技术

数据去重技术可以去除全景视频数据中的重复信息,减少存储空间占用。常用的数据去重技术有:

  • 哈希算法: 通过计算数据的哈希值,判断数据是否重复。
  • 差分算法: 计算新旧数据之间的差异,仅存储差异部分。

案例分析:某安防公司采用哈希算法对全景视频数据进行去重,有效降低了存储空间占用。


  1. 边缘计算

边缘计算可以将数据处理和存储任务下放到边缘节点,降低中心节点的负担。边缘计算在全景视频数据存储中的应用包括:

  • 视频编码: 在边缘节点进行视频编码,减少中心节点的计算压力。
  • 数据存储: 在边缘节点存储部分数据,降低数据传输成本。

案例分析:某智能交通系统采用边缘计算技术,将视频编码和数据存储任务下放到路侧边缘节点,提高了系统性能。

四、总结

全景视频监控系统在数据存储方面面临诸多挑战,但通过采用数据压缩、分布式存储、数据去重和边缘计算等技术,可以有效实现高效存储。未来,随着技术的不断发展,全景视频监控系统在数据存储方面的性能将得到进一步提升。

猜你喜欢:可观测性平台